Show J Thousand Jars Explode London May 7At the cordite works f near Waltham Abbey this afternoon thousands o jars of nitrate and sulphuric 1 sul-phuric acid exploded Four persons were killed and thirty injured j Later Intelligence shows that the explosion plosion occurred at the Cordite works in the sheds where the men were at work washing nitro glycerine The building was situated in an extensive field about half a mile from the about mie government ment gunpowder factory The gunpoder factor explosion set fire to a shed thirty yards distant in which more nitro glycerine w j stored and caused a second explosion Most of the persons Injured were struck by falling glass and debris Their injuries juries in most cases are slight Portions j of the bodies of the four men killed were found at a great distance from the spot where the shed was located Mr Bennie the chemist in charge of the J shed is among the killed |
